

The crisis in Ukraine has influenced the way in which the security options of the Republic of Moldova are analyzed. On the other hand, this phenomenon determined an increased interest from the European structures towards the Republic of Moldova. These two aspects of the crisis from Ukraine reflect the uncertainty persisting in the Moldovan society related to the security of the territory under the State border. It should be mentioned that the crisis in Ukraine determined a retreatment reaction on behalf of the Government of the Republic of Moldova, which came back to a reactive and defensive behavior in relation to Russia. At the same time, such a reaction led to the resuscitation of some pro-NATO attitudes expressed during the election campaign (autumn 2014) by the liberal parties. This behavior also reflects an old cleavage from the Republic of Moldova – the neutrality adepts versus those who support the joining of the country to the North-Atlantic Alliance. In this context, this article will assess the main trends in the security system of the Republic of Moldova from the perspective of the Ukrainian crisis consequences. And finally, we cannot neglect the fact that the Republic of Moldova – a state with profound vulnerabilities in the area of security and defense – should be concerned more than ever with the assessment of the alternatives existing for ensuring its own security. Unfortunately, the political instability, but mainly the lack of will, courage, and vision among the ruling parties, has determined the lack of any progress in the area related to enhancing the capacities of the country in the area of security and defense.
